NEED TO PROTECT SOCIAL SECURITY
(Mr. NORCROSS asked and was given permission to address the House for
1 minute.)
Mr. NORCROSS. Mr. Speaker, I am here to speak about the need to
protect Social Security.
Last year, the Republicans passed an expensive tax scam that gave 83
percent of the benefits to the top 1 percent. This and the new tax scam
2.0 will add trillions to our deficit.
Now they are trying to use this massive deficit that they created to
justify cutting and dismantling Social Security, all while a retirement
security crisis is looming to wreak havoc on those who are going to
retire over the next decade.
One in three Americans have less than $5,000--one in three have less
than $5,000--saved. Fewer have pensions. For so many families who have
worked hard, played by the rules, Social Security is all they will
have. And Republicans, they want to take it away.
Mr. Speaker, let's build up Social Security, not dismantle it.
